 * Hi, I’ve got this error log many times today and yesterday.
 * `ERROR: cannot infer mimetype from extension in /home/customer/www/shoes4me.gr/
   public_html/wp-content/plugins/ti-woocommerce-wishlist/assets/fonts/tinvwl-webfont.
   woff2 , set --type or --mime explicitly`
 * can you assist me?

 * The error means that you need to configure your webserver to server proper MIME
   type for .woff2 file extension. Almost all modern webfonts using this format 
   because it’s most compressed by file size.
 * Please, contact your hosting support with this request.
    We can’t fix it from
   our side.
